Gold and Silver: Safe Havens
- Historical Performance: Gold and silver have traditionally been viewed as safe-haven assets. In times of uncertainty, investors often turn to these metals to preserve their wealth.
- Inflation Hedge: Both gold and silver serve as hedges against inflation, making them desirable during economic fluctuations.
Impact of Interest Rate Freeze
A freeze on interest rates could have multiple effects:
- Investor Sentiment: Stability in rate policy may boost investor confidence, which can lead to increased demand for gold and silver.
- Opportunity Costs: With higher interest rates, the opportunity cost of holding non-yielding assets like gold and silver tends to rise. Conversely, a freeze may keep these costs low, supporting prices.
- Portfolio Diversification: Investors may seek to diversify their holdings, further enhancing the appeal of precious metals during uncertain economic times.
